The MIC2090 and MIC2091 are high-side MOSFET power switches optimized for general-purpose 50mA or 100mA low power distribution in circuits requiring over-current limiting and circuit protection.

1.8V to 5.5V supply voltage

790 mΩ typical RDSON at 3.3V

MIC2090 is rated for 50mA minimum continuous current

MIC2091 is rated for 100mA minimum continuous current

Reverse current blocking (OGI)

20ns super fast reaction time to hard short at output

10ms fault flag delay (tD_FAULT/) eliminates false assertions

Auto-retry overcurrent and short-circuit protection (-1 version)

Latch-off on current limit (-2 version)

Thermal shutdown

Fault status flag indicates: over-current, over-temperature, or UVLO

Under-voltage lockout (UVLO)

Low quiescent current
